Transaction ed2fa326041cd2fc274e7927f2e2b3f6810f4139fc881df5c701dfc6cf2aabde

1 Input
1 Outputs
  • ed2fa326041cd2fc274e7927f2e2b3f6810f4139fc881df5c701dfc6cf2aabde:0
  • value  1403498
    address  1CsNStWjRQuCyHMapXKEqDbSKpYKCjch47